How to Get Every Upgrade and Crafting Material in Diablo 4
Delving into the world of Diablo 4, you’ll come across various crafting materials essential for brewing potions, elixirs, and incense. Additionally, upgrade materials play a vital role in enhancing your weapons, armor, and jewelry. Below, we’ve compiled comprehensive lists of these valuable resources and their respective uses and locations:
Plants & Herbs
Material | Rarity | Description | How to Obtain |
---|---|---|---|
Biteberry | Magic | An herb used in the crafting of potions, elixirs, and incense. A hard, bitter berry prized by alchemists for its enduring and defensive qualities. | Found in Fractured Peaks. |
Blightshade | Magic | An herb used in the crafting of potions, elixirs, and incense. A toxic swamp lily, prized by alchemists for its foul and aggressive qualities. | Found in Hawezar. |
Gallowvine | Magic | An herb used in the crafting of potions, elixirs, and incense. Considered foundational to alchemy, it enhances and binds with other elixirs. | Can be found nearly everywhere. |
Howler Moss | Magic | An herb used in the crafting of potions, elixirs, and incense. A hoary moss with a pungent, musky aroma, prized for its vital and physical qualities. | Found in Scosglen. |
Lifesbane | Magic | An herb used in the crafting of potions, elixirs, and incense. A native Kehjistani berry with an eerie face, prized for its potent toxins and effects. | Found in Kehjistan. |
Reddamine | Magic | A fungus used in the crafting of potions, elixirs, and incense. Coveted by alchemists for its stimulating and energizing properties. | Found in Dry Steppes. |
Angelbreath | Rare | A rare herb used in the crafting of elixirs. A precious strain of lily-of-the-valley, considered an alchemical catalyst of few peers. | Can be found nearly everywhere |
Fiend Rose | Rare | An exceptionally hard-to-find herb. Despite its beauty, it possesses some toxicity, making it a prized catalyst for alchemists. | Found during the Helltide when Hell’s influence takes hold. |
Ores
Material | Rarity | Description | How to Get |
---|---|---|---|
Iron Chunk | Common | Metal used for improving weapons and jewelry. A common, dark ore that while heavy results in clean, useful metal and used by artisans throughout Sanctuary. | Found in veins nearly everywhere. |
Silver Ore | Magic | Rare metal used for improving weapons and jewelry. Silver is prized by artisans for both its beauty and potency against dangerous creatures throughout Sanctuary. | Found in veins nearly everywhere. |
Scattered Prism | Rare | A mysterious prism used for adding sockets to gear. Rare and hoarded by their previous owners, these prisms are often guarded jealously. | Most often found in very, very large bodies, such as world bosses. |
Skins
Material | Rarity | Description | How to Obtain |
---|---|---|---|
Rawhide | Common | Common leather used for improving armor. Coarse, rugged leather used for garments, tools, and toys for the hounds of Sanctuary. | Can be obtained from various wildlife and beasts. |
Superior Leather | Magic | Rare leather used for improving armor. Supple, rugged leather used for fine garments and even finer armor. | Can be obtained from various wildlife and beasts. |
Monster Parts
Material | Rarity | Description | How to Get |
---|---|---|---|
Crushed Beast Bones | Magic | Within the bones of wild creatures dwells a raw potency used by alchemists to enhance physical properties. | Found by defeating beasts, animals, and werecreatures. |
Demon’s Heart | Magic | Each Demon still carries a withered, beating heart that propels it forward. Rarely they are left in fine enough condition after the Demon is slain to use for other means. | Found in the bodies of demons. |
Grave Dust | Magic | Long exposure to the walking dead imbues this dust with their inverse vitality, used in necromantic alchemies. | Found in the bodies, bones, or cerements of the undead. |
Paletongue | Magic | The lies spouted by particularly black-hearted humans rarely manifest in turning their tongues a milky white. | Found in the mouths of evil humans. |
Salvageable Materials
Material | Rarity | Description | How to Obtain |
---|---|---|---|
Abstruse Sigil | Legendary | Salvaged from, and used to improve, Legendary jewelry. Fragments from storied relics and talismans with truly unusual properties. | Salvage Legendary Jewelry. |
Baleful Fragment | Legendary | Salvaged from, and used to improve, Legendary weapons. Shards from storied weapons with truly unusual properties. | Salvage Legendary Weapons. |
Coiling Ward | Legendary | Salvaged from, and used to improve, Legendary armor. Fragments from storied armor with truly unusual properties. | Salvage Legendary Armor. |
Forgotten Soul | Legendary | Found in ore veins erupting during the Helltide. Used to improve sacred and ancestral items. Is it a stone, an organ, or something else? Indescribably, it is all of these things. | Obtain from Ore veins in the active Helltide zone. |
Sigil Powder | Common | Obtained by using the Occultist to salvage nightmare sigils of any tier. A mysterious powder that can be compressed into relics inviting peril for greater challenges and rewards. | Salvage Nightmare Sigils with the Occultist. |
Veiled Crystal | Rare | Salvaged from Rare weapons and armor, and used to alter the latent Magic of things. Occultists and enchanters commonly use these crystals for magical manipulation. | Salvage Rare Weapons and Armor. |
